The portfolio presents nine named projects, including a live dual-EEG synchrony rig, an SSVEP speller, an EMG-controlled exoskeleton, and a hand-painted neurofeedback device. Its capability inventory connects experimental neuroscience to practical build work: LSL/XDF synchronization, PyTorch and Bayesian modeling, pose-estimation systems, sensor integration, 3D printing, Unity, Unreal, and Blender. The page also includes technical loop diagrams showing how signals become features, decisions, and feedback.
